    Pooja Preparation: Timing & Sacred Items (Pooja Samagri) 

    Before performing the energization ritual, preparation is everything. Just as a seed needs fertile soil, your Rudraksha needs the right environment and devotion.

    Auspicious Timing:

    • Best Time: Early morning during Brahma Muhurat (approximately 4–6 AM).

    • Highly auspicious days: 

      • Mahashivratri – The night of Shiva’s divine energy.

      • Shravan Month (Sawan) – Entirely dedicated to Lord Shiva.

      • Full Moon (Poornima) – Enhances spiritual strength.

      • New Moon (Amavasya) – Excellent for inner cleansing and new beginnings.

    The Complete Samagri List:

    • Buy an authentic rudraksha mala or bead, as suggested by your astrologer
    • Get a copper plate or a clean white cloth
    • Sandalwood paste (Chandan Paste)

    • Prepare Panchamrit or Panchgavya (mix of milk, honey, ghee, curd, and Ganga Jal)

    • Incense sticks (Dhoop/Agarbatti) and a ghee lamp (Diya)

    • Fresh white flowers

    • A clean mat (Asan) facing East or North

    Step-by-Step Rudraksha Energization (The Pran Pratishtha Puja Vidhi)

    Now comes the heart of the process, the Rudraksha Energization Ritual, also called the Pran Pratishtha. Follow these simple steps with devotion and focus.

    Purification & Cleansing (Shuddhikaran):

    Take a bath and wear clean clothes. Wash your Rudraksha with plain water, then dip it in Panchamrit (or a mix of raw milk and honey) for purification. Rinse it gently again with Ganga Jal or clean water.

    Set Up the Sacred Space:

    Arrange your pooja space/altar neatly. Place the clean Rudraksha on a copper plate or white cloth. Light the Diya and incense. Sit on your Asan, facing East (for growth) or North (for spiritual upliftment).

    Intention (Sankalpa):

    Close your eyes and state your purpose. For example, “I wear this Rudraksha to gain peace, clarity, and divine connection,” or whatever your goal is to wear the Rudraksha. 

    Mantra Activation:

    Apply sandalwood paste to the bead. Hold it in your right hand and chant the main Shiva mantra Om Namah Shivay (ॐ नमः शिवाय) 108 times.

    Beej Mantra:

    If it’s a specific Mukhi, chant its corresponding Beej Mantra too.

    For example: 5 Mukhi: “Om Hreem Namah”

    Offerings (Arpan):

    Offer fresh flowers, Diya, and incense to the Rudraksha while expressing gratitude.

    Final Blessing:

    Touch the bead to a Shivling or Lord Shiva’s image, then wear it while chanting “Om Namah Shivaya” nine times.

    FAQs

    1. How often should I re-energize my Rudraksha?

    Ideally, re-energize it every 6 to 12 months, especially on Mondays or during Shravan month. You can also cleanse and chant “Om Namah Shivaya” on Poornima or Amavasya to refresh its energy.

    2. Can I energize Rudraksha at home, or do I need a Pandit/Priest?

    You can easily energize it at home with devotion and the right steps. A Pandit is not mandatory, but if you prefer a traditional approach, you can consult one for guidance during the first energization.

    3. Can I wear Rudraksha while sleeping or bathing?

    It’s generally fine to wear it while sleeping, but avoid wearing it during a bath or while using soaps and detergents, as chemicals can harm the bead’s natural surface and energy.

    4. How do I know if my Rudraksha is working?

    You may start feeling calmer, more focused, or spiritually connected within days or weeks. The bead’s energy subtly harmonizes with your aura, so trust the process; it's gentle but powerful.

    5. What should I do if my Rudraksha breaks or cracks?

    If it breaks naturally, it’s believed that it has absorbed or completed its karmic purpose. You can respectfully immerse it in a river or under a sacred tree and replace it with a new one.
